Macaroni Grill - Lots of buzz 4/16/2006

There was a lot of buzz when Macaroni Grill announced it was opening in Hawaii at Ala Moana Center. I ate at a location in New York a few years ago and wasn't exactly bowled over. However, with the way everyone carried on about it, I was intrigued. I went for lunch with others from the office. The food was good, though I know some of the others were disappointed with what they had. My dish was good, just not really memorable. What was disappointing was the service. It was just really slow. It was hard to fault the server, because it didn't seem like it was something she could control. Normally I dismiss these kinds of experiences and give the restaurants the benefit of the doubt. However, I've heard similar stories of slow service, so it makes you wonder if there's something more to it. more

Good food, but inconsistent 3/29/2006

I’ve tried the food at Macaroni Grill four times now. On two occasions, I’ve tried their Rib Eye steak, and have even recommended it to a friend. The first time was the best. The steak was almost ¾” inches thick, with a wonderful sauce. The second time around, my steak was about ¼” and there was hardly any of that rich sauce. My friend that I recommended the steak to, was also disappointed. All of their meals start off with bread and olive oil. I always have to ask for the balsamic vinegar. But if you ask – you shall receive. more

Another Good Italian Option 1/15/2006

A Mainland chain, sure, but one certainly welcome in a town that hungers for more (if not better) Italian options. We went during their soft-opening, and again last week, and loved it. Family friendly (a plus for us and our three kids), decent portions for a reasonable price. The kitchen speed has been a bit uneven - main courses sometimes beat the salad or appetizers to your table - but the servers are sharp and friendly and no dishes were lacking in richness or flavor (I always end up taking almost half of my order home). As with the opening of other major chains (notably the Cheesecake Factory in Waikiki), right now the line to get in can be long -- show up at 6 p.m. on a Friday, and you'll have to wait an hour or more. But, at least with its location within Honolulu's retail Mecca, there's no shortage of things to browse to pass the time. Presumably, in a few months, the lines will subside (especially as other new dining options open in Hookipa Terrace). more

Not bad for being open just a month 12/2/2005

If you've been to Macaroni Grill on the mainland, you KNOW how good this place is. The food here still rocks, although they made a minor mistake with my order (I ordered the "make your own pasta" and they put in mushrooms instead of the red peppers I had requested). The bread is so ono, but smaller than the loaves on the mainland--and the prices are slightly higher as well. The service was okay--not terrible but not great. They were busy, but not enough to justify the lower level of service. I have to admit, though, when we couldn't get our server, another one helped us out quite nicely. The ambience is cozy, the lighting is dim, but the place is super LOUD. It's a family restaurant that wants to be a romantic one. Kind of like Buca di Beppo, but with smaller portions. Get there early (5pmish) if you want to avoid a long wait. more
